On Fri, 13 Feb 2015 08:35:00 -0500 Ben Hoyt <benhoyt@gmail.com> wrote:
If we go ahead with the all C approach, I'd be in favour of refactoring a little and putting the new scandir code into a separate C file. There are two ways to do this: a) sticking with a single Python module and just referencing the non-static functions in scandir.c from posixmodule.c, or b) sharing some functions but making _scandir.c its own importable module. Option (a) is somewhat simpler as there's not module setup stuff twice, but I don't know if there's a precedent for that way of doing things.
The _io module already does things that way (the (a) option, I mean). Regards Antoine.
